Thread: DeathRun TV announcement trailer


Welcome to Deathrun TV. This world premiere announcement trailer introduces you to this Roguelike with an attitude. A gameshow shooter where you earn likes for dunking on competitors and causing wanton destruction.

You can play the pilot right now on Steam